State Bank of Mysore appoints Sharad Sharma as MD

Sharma will hold the position for two years

Sharad Sharma has been appointed as the managing director of State Bank of Mysore.

"State Bank of Mysore has informed that State Bank of India has appointed Sharad Sharma as Managing Director of the Bank for a period of two years from the date of his assuming charge vide gazette notification July 23, 2012," the bank said in a BSE filing today.

Sharma took charge from August 13, 2012.

The bank said its previous MD Dilip Mavinkurve has retired from the service on attaining superannuation on March 31, 2012.

State Bank of Mysore shares were trading at Rs 475.30 apiece in the afternoon trade, up 1.57% from the previous close.
